Ingredients Needed
Are you ready to get started on making your very own tropical pina colada smoothie? Before you grab your blender, make sure you have these ingredients on hand:
Ingredients | Amount |
---|---|
Pineapple Chunks | 1 cup |
Coconut Milk | 1 cup |
Vanilla Yogurt | 1/2 cup |
Ice Cubes | 1 cup |
Rum (optional) | 1-2 shots |
Preparing the Ingredients
Once you have all of your ingredients, it’s time to prepare them for blending. Here are some helpful tips to ensure your smoothie comes out perfectly:
Pineapple Chunks
You can use fresh or canned pineapple chunks for this recipe. If you opt for canned pineapple, make sure to drain the juice first. For fresh pineapple, cut the fruit into small chunks and remove the core.
Coconut Milk
Shake the can of coconut milk before opening to ensure that the milk and cream are well combined. You can use either full-fat or light coconut milk, depending on your preference.
Vanilla Yogurt
Using vanilla yogurt in this recipe gives the smoothie a nice creamy texture and added sweetness. If you prefer a tangy smoothie, you can use plain yogurt instead.
Ice Cubes
Adding ice cubes to your smoothie helps to thicken it up and give it a slushy consistency. If you don’t have any ice on hand, you can use frozen pineapple chunks instead.
Rum (optional)
For those looking for a little kick in their smoothie, add in a shot or two of rum. This will give your smoothie that classic pina colada taste.
Blending the Smoothie
Now that your ingredients are prepped and ready to go, it’s time to blend them together. Here’s how to make the perfect pina colada smoothie:
1. Add the pineapple chunks, coconut milk, yogurt, ice cubes, and rum (if using) to a blender.
2. Blend on high speed until all ingredients are well combined and you have a smooth and creamy consistency.
3. Taste the smoothie and adjust the sweetness or tanginess as needed by adding more pineapple or yogurt.
4. Pour the smoothie into glasses and serve immediately with a slice of fresh pineapple or a fun umbrella for that tropical touch.
